A coworker had to diagnose an electrical problem on a ‘18 Tacoma. A fuse would pop when the turn signals were used, disabling the cluster in the process. After some searching, he looked at the factory trailer harness in the back and didn’t notice something weird at first, then he saw it.
Somehow... someone stuffed a hitch ball reducer bushing in there and it fitted really neatly around the pins (7 pins connector). Not sure why only one fuse was giving up the ghost when basically everything was shorting with everything... but that’s some impressive level of stupidity. Turns out that a salesman saw the bushing on the ground behind the truck that was in the delivery parking and thought that it magically opened the spring loaded trap and jumped on the pavement. So being a good guy, he stuffed a conductive metal bushing around pins that shouldn’t be all connected together. Wish I took a pic, but I didn’t have time.
